Why Battery Choice Matters in Medical Devices

Medical wearables must operate in critical healthcare scenarios, where safety, reliability, and long battery life can directly impact patient outcomes. Unlike consumer gadgets, medical devices cannot afford overheating, sudden shutdowns, or performance instability. This is where MOTOMA’s medical-grade lithium polymer batteries stand out.

Market Outlook: The Role of Batteries in Smart Healthcare

A recent study by Deloitte shows that 65% of consumers are now open to using wearable devices to track health data, a trend accelerated by telemedicine and the need for remote care during the pandemic. By 2030, experts predict that medical wearables will be integrated into standard healthcare practices, with continuous glucose monitors (CGMs), ECG trackers, and smart biosensors becoming part of routine check-ups.

But as devices become more advanced, their power requirements grow. Manufacturers face a challenge: how to balance small size, high energy density, and safety compliance.
